Cultivar Notes -
Alba (White)
Also known as Sea Pink. Globe-shaped white flowers on dwarf plants, late spring-summer. Use for edging, ground cover.
Species Notes -
Armeria maritima
Thrift are native to seaside cliffs, and are durable perennials for most any sunny location.
Genus Notes -
Armeria
Armerias are showy plants that present their flowers in dense, globe-shaped heads above clumps of grasslike leaves. They are all the more valuable because they are adaptable, growing and flowering both in heavy clay and poor sandy soil. Small, attractive mounds of tufted evergreen, grass-like leaves, very floriferous in spring and early summer. Plants are salt tolerant and are often grown along the coastline. Excellent for use as edging or in rock gardens.
